Whalesuckers and a spinner dolphin bonded for weeks: does host fidelity pay off? Biota Neotropica
Silva-Jr,José Martins; Sazima,Ivan.
The whalesucker Remora australis (Echeneidae) is an oceanic diskfish found attached to cetaceans only and its habits are therefore poorly known. At the Fernando de Noronha Archipelago, off North-eastern Brazil, spinner dolphins Stenella longirostris (Delphinidae) regularly congregate in large groups in a shallow bay, which allows for underwater observations of their behaviour and their fish associates. In the course of a broader study of this elusive diskfish, we had the opportunity to made multiple records of two whalesucker couples (three of the fish naturally marked) attached to the same individual dolphin in two different years, over periods of 47 and 87 days respectively. PRESENCIA DE REMORINA ALBESCENS (PERCIFORMES: ECHENEIDAE) EN EL CARIBE COLOMBIANO, INCLUYENDO UNA CLAVE DE IDENTIFICACIÓN PARA LAS ESPECIES DE LA FAMILIA EN COLOMBIA Boletín de Investigaciones
Farfán López,Edwin; Acero P.,Arturo; Grijalba-Bendeck,Marcela.
The presence of Remorina albescens for the Colombian Caribbean is confirmed, based on a specimen of 165.91 mm of standard length collected in Nenguanje bay at the Tayrona National Natural Park. A taxonomic key for the remoras known from Colombian seas is also included.
